Shape our draft design proposals to improve Brimmington Park

We want to hear your views on a draft design proposal to shape improvements to Brimmington Park, near Old Kent Road in North Peckham.  The park is owned and run by Southwark Council.

Over the last year, we consulted people, to find out what improvements they would like to see at Brimmington Park.  The views and ideas of thirty two people who responded were considered and included in the updated draft design proposals for the park:

  • keep the tree previously proposed for removal by re-aligning the path
  • have more benches
  • increase cycle rack provision
  • have an additional informal play area with elements such as rocks, balance beams and logs
  • retain and repair or replace the gym equipment
  • retain graffiti where possible

Their views and ideas are included in the consultation report here.

The proposed sports centre includes a dedicated reception with control gates in the foyer. The access route is shown by arrows on the updated design, as requested during the first consultation.

The council’s fees and charges will apply to the use of the new pitches.  The fees and charges will contribute towards maintaining the facility and staffing costs.

Concern was raised that the sports pitches would always require costly fees in order to use them. This is not the case and information about the management of the new facility and free-use can be found on the project  website. However we expect there to be capacity for free use at most off-peak times, as shown by the indicative programme.

Why your views matter

We are doing a consultation on the suggested designs and improvements to the sports facility, play and landscape areas, to improve the quality and increase use of the sports pitches and to make the park more appealing for everyone.

This second consultation provides a proposed single design, which has been updated and shaped by the opinions provided during the first consultation phase.

It is important that local people have a chance to tell us what they think and we welcome their feedback on the design ideas.

 

What happens next

At each step of the way will update you by email (providing you have given us your email address in the survey). The findings from this consultation will be published on the project webpage, shared with the local Tenant Resident Associations (TRA’s), stakeholders and Ward Councillors and published in the Old Kent Road's newsletter. The results will be used to shape the final design plans.

We expect to submit a detailed planning application that people can comment on, in winter 2020. Construction of the new sports facility is currently programmed to commence in 2021.
